Thursday April 2nd - The Latest

Posted by The GetUp Team, April 2nd, 2009

Today marks national Close The Gap day, a day of action to show support for closing the 17-year life expectancy gap between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islanders and other Australians.

In a historic move, the federal government will tomorrow announce a formal statement of support for the United Nations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ples - a statement the previous government voted against in 2007. You can find out more about the Declaration here.

Social Justice Commissioner Tom Calma today stated that the move of support should be backed immediately with a comprehensive national action plan to Close The Gap in health equality between Indigenous and non-Indigenous Australians.



Friday 27th February 2009 - The Latest

Posted by The GetUp Team, February 27th, 2009

The Rudd Government has come under fire for failing to deliver on the apology promise to Close The Gap in Indigenous life expectancy.

Delivering the first annual report to Parliament, PM Rudd defended the Government's record on Indigenous affairs in the last year but promised to work harder to end disadvantage in Indigenous life expectancy and announced $58 million to tackle trachoma in Indigenous communities.

The Government continues to come under scrutiny however for its continued suspension of the Racial Discrimination Act in the Northern Territory as part of the NTER.
